Output 6642956b588d7cd9eb79cdb30bc148bf2d3a74adddc9ed7ab53ef6dfef2fbca6:0

value
528066
script pubkey
OP_0 OP_PUSHBYTES_20 ce95b21eb66a27833b31063c2edbad21d2076b46
address
bc1qe62my84kdgncxwe3qc7zakady8fqw66xdpjdtj
transaction
6642956b588d7cd9eb79cdb30bc148bf2d3a74adddc9ed7ab53ef6dfef2fbca6
spent
true